Enhancing Arabic Vocabulary Mastery with the Singing Method

The Importance of Learning Vocabulary in Language Mastery

Vocabulary is usually the first thing taught when someone is learning a new language. A language’s vocabulary is its basic foundation.

A person will find it difficult to express their ideas, understand conversations, or write effectively if they lack a sufficient vocabulary.

Communication is made more effective with vocabulary.

An extensive vocabulary allows people to understand the meaning of both written and spoken sentences.

Someone will still not understand the intended meaning of a sentence, for example, if they understand its structure but not the meanings associated with the words.

On the contrary, someone who has an extensive vocabulary may still convey their ideas simply and effectively even if they are not great at constructing sentences.

Actually, learning Arabic is challenging for many students.

Understanding vocabulary is one of the challenges, as it is key to understanding, communicating, and writing in Arabic.

This weak mastery is mostly caused by the complexity of the Arabic language structure and a lack of interesting teaching and learning approaches.

Memorizing is not enough for vocabulary learning.

If vocabulary can be used in real contexts, such sentences, dialogues, or writing, it will be more effectively to learn.

Students that learn language in a monotonous, textbook-focused way sometimes get bored and unmotivated.

And therefore, a teaching method that can enhances students’ motivation to learn while also making learning fun is needed.

Singing is one method that can meet this condition.

It has been proved that which combines elements of music with language learning enhances student engagement and accelerates in vocabulary learning and memorizing.

Singing Method’s Impact on Students’ Learning Motivation

Many students find learning Arabic to be difficult and boring.

Vocabulary learning is one of the greatest difficulties because it is important for understanding and using Arabic.

Because of boring methods of teaching, many students find it difficult to memorize vocabulary.

Singing can be one of the most interesting methods among the various innovative approaches used for language teaching.

Teachers can teach material in language in a more interesting and memorable way by integrating songs into the lesson strategies.

From the perspective of learning motivation, singing can make the classroom fun and enhance students’ motivation to learn Arabic.

Students actively engage in learning activities rather than passively listening to the teacher talk.

However, not every student is appropriate for this method because not every student is as interested in singing or music.

Teachers should adapt the songs to the material and the developmental needs of the students.

While too-simple songs may bore students, too-complex songs can confuse them.

Therefore, the teacher’s creativity in specifying or selecting appropriate songs and combining it with other methods like games, conversations, or direct practice is important.

The singing method effectively increases students’ motivation to learn Arabic, every aspect considered.

This method is not only entertaining but also helps with student engagement, pronunciation, and memory.

In view of the difficulties affecting educational institutions, innovations such as these are urgently needed to provide a learning atmosphere that is both effective and pleasurable.

Strategies for Implementing the Singing Method in Arabic Learning

One of the fun ways to learn Arabic is to apply the singing method.

This method helps students learn vocabulary and sentence structures more quickly while also revitalizing the classroom atmosphere.

A few factors must be considered seriously if one wants to enhance the effectiveness of this method.

First, the songs must be appropriate for the lesson’s topic material.

As an example, the song you choose must contain lyrics that mention about the various bodily parts if you are studying it. Second, when it comes to composing or selecting songs, teachers need to be more creativity.

Sometimes teachers can create their own songs with lyrics that match to the lesson material it’s not always necessary for them to be formal or children’s songs.

A popular rhythm can be used in the music to make it easy for students to follow along.

Another strategy, this method can be used to draw students in at the beginning of the lesson or as a way to review the material at the end.

To prevent students from getting bored too quickly, it can also be utilized as an in the middle break.

Teachers must be able to actively engage the students in learning instead of just letting them listen.

Example, they can be asked to sing a song together, guess the words that are missing from the lyrics, or create a song using the words they have recently learned.

In this method, they not only learn words with memory but also understand how they are used in sentences.

So the strategy for implementing this method into practice goes beyond just singing; it also considers how songs can be used as a fun and meaningful method for learning Arabic.
